Jae LaShonJae LaShon
Cool restaurant, nice employees even though we had to ask other employees to find out server several times, good drinks. But the food was terrible all except the fried pickles which were good. Ordered a draft DOMESTIC Blue Moon which was the special of the day. Was told that blue moon is not considered domestic so was charged the regular price. Then when I wanted another one, was told the drafts were not working. Then the price of the nachos were wrong because our Server told us they were a certain price only during a certain time. We were not informed of any if this until after the bill came. Server knocked My entire cup.of water on our table and in me. Never came and got the water off of the floor so we were slipping trying to get out of the booth. My husband got chips and queso (very bland and watery). I ordered the southwest grilled chicken plate with veggie medley and a house salad... HORRIBLE. The chicken was paper thin and burnt smothered in jalapenos that were raw and then a piece of white cheese was placed on top. I couldn't chew it. The veggies were unseasoned and undone. And was charged for salad dressing that was suppose to be with the salad. My husband ordered the triple decker sandwich which I could have made at home. My meal was comped but the rest came up to $40 and was not worth $20. I don't know if we will be returning to Sammys

Sherri BurksSherri Burks
We really enjoyed this place, which was recommended by our hotel as a non-chain restaurant. My husband and I loved the laid-back atmosphere and noticed guys in there who look like "the regulars" just hanging out and having a good time. Lots of sports on different TVs, so you're sure to find something that interests you. Not only was the atmosphere great, but the food was fantastic!! Our server, Makee, recommended the chicken salad sandwich, and it was delicious with a side of onion rings. My husband had to order us a second basket of them, because he kept eating all of mine! Makee made us feel right at home and was attentive to whatever we needed. I am from Houston and have been to plenty of restaurants, and this place has the triple threat of great food, atmosphere, and friendly, fun staff. If I could give more than 5 stars, I would!
